Iglesuela del Cid, Spain

Iglesuela del Cid, Spain

Iglesuela del Cid Spain

Recommended airport
Valencia (VLC)
Nearby destinations
  • Cantavieja a 6.95 km
  • Mora de Rubielos a 43.26 km
  • Morella a 24.04 km